Angelina was back in the Northeast after taking a trip down to Alabama over the weekend to join her daughter Zahara.
The college student appeared to have been inspired by her mother’s work as a Special Envoy for the United Nations High Commissioner for Refugees, as the subject of her keynote speech was ‘period poverty.’
The term refers to situations in which women and girls have ‘insufficient access to menstrual products, education, and sanitation facilities’ according to the National Institutes of Health.
Zahara has been a student at Spelman College, a historically Black women’s liberal arts college, since the fall of 2022, and she joined the Alpha Kappa Alpha sorority the following year.
In addition to Zahara, whom she adopted from Ethiopia in 2005, Jolie shares five other children with her ex-husband Brad Pitt.
She first adopted her son Maddox, 23, in 2002, and Pitt later adopted both children.

Although their divorce has been finalized, the legal battle over Château Miraval, a celebrated French wine estate, remains contentious.
Pitt has accused Jolie of selling her stake in the winery to the Stoli Group, known for its Stolichnaya vodka, without his consent.
Despite progress in their divorce proceedings, the vineyard dispute shows no signs of resolution.
Sources told DailyMail.com that both parties are prepared to take the matter to a jury trial or pursue mediation if necessary.
